Ban on building houses along Ravi

LAHORE: The Punjab government has imposed an immediate ban on construction of new houses along the banks of the River Ravi.

Heavy fines would be imposed on han violators and they might be put behind the bars, officials said on Wednesday.

It is pertinent to mention that thousands of families have been building houses illegally along the river banks and government agencies have failed to check this practice. Now a ban has been imposed to discourage further construction along the river.

According to a survey, hundreds of families are residing on the dry riverbed without taking into consideration the danger of sudden rise in the water level.

An Irsa official said there were chances of large-scale damages if India released water into the Ravi. He said mushroom growth of houses close to the river could be dangerous, especially in summer.

According to a city district government official, a land mafia is operating to promote 1(atchi abadis in the area.— APP
